Full specifications and technical details 2003 Audi A3 (8P) 1.6 (102 Hp)

Overview:

What is the engine capacity of a Audi A3 2003?
The engine capacity of the Audi A3 2003 is 1595 cm.

Audi A3 2003 How many horsepower?
The engine power of the Audi A3 2003 is 102 Hp @ 5600 rpm..

What is the Audi A3 2003 engine?
Audi A3 2003 engine is BGU, BSE, BSF. (Click to see other cars using the same engine)

How much gasoline does a Audi A3 2003 consume?
The Audi A3 2003 consumes 7 liters of gasoline per 100 km

General:

Brand: Audi
Model: A3
Generation: A3 (8P)
Modification (Engine): 1.6 (102 Hp)
Start of production: 2003
End of production: 2005
Powertrain Architecture: Internal Combustion Engine
Body type:Hatchback
Seats: 5
Doors: 3

Engine:

Power: 102 hp @ 5600 rpm.
Power per litre: 63.9 hp/l
Torque: 148 nm @ 3800 rpm.
Engine Model/Code:BGU, BSE, BSF
Engine displacement: 1595 cm
Number of cylinders: 4
Engine configuration: Inline
Number of valves per cylinder: 2
Fuel injection system: Multi-port manifold injection
Engine aspiration: Naturally aspirated Engine
Valvetrain: SOHC
Engine oil capacity: 4.6 l
Coolant: 8 l
Engine layout: Front, Transverse
Cylinder Bore: 81 mm
Piston Stroke: 77.4 mm
Compression ratio: 10.3

Performance:

Fuel Type: Petrol (Gasoline)
Fuel consumption (economy) - urban: 9.6 l/100 km
Fuel consumption (economy) - extra urban: 5.5 l/100 km
Fuel consumption (economy) - combined: 7 l/100 km
Emission standard: Euro 4
Acceleration 0 - 100 km/h: 11.9 sec
Acceleration 0 - 62 mph: 11.9 sec
Maximum speed: 185 km/h
Weight-to-power ratio: 11.8 kg/Hp, 84.6 Hp/tonne
Weight-to-torque ratio: 8.1 kg/Nm, 122.8 Nm/tonne
Acceleration 0 - 60 mph: 11.3 sec

Space:

Kerb Weight: 1205 kg
Max. weight: 1765 kg
Max. roof load: 75 kg
Max load: 560 kg
Trunk (boot) space - maximum: 1100 l
Trunk (boot) space - minimum: 350 l
Permitted trailer load with brakes (12%): 1200 kg
Fuel tank capacity: 55 l
Permitted trailer load without brakes: 640 kg
Permitted towbar download: 75 kg
Permitted trailer load with brakes (8%): 1500 kg

dimensions:

Length: 4203 mm
Width: 1765 mm
Height: 1421 mm
wheelbase: 2578 mm
Front track: 1536 mm
Rear (Back) track: 1517 mm
Minimum turning circle (turning diameter): 10.7 m

Powertrain, Suspension and Brakes:

Drivetrain Architecture: The Internal combustion Engine (ICE) drives the front wheels of the vehicle.
Drive wheel: Front wheel drive
Number of gears and type of gearbox: 5 gears, manual transmission
Front brakes: Ventilated discs
Rear brakes: Disc
Assisting systems: ABS (Anti-lock braking system)
Steering type: Steering rack and pinion
Power steering: Electric Steering
Tires size: 205/55 R16
Wheel rims size: 6.5J X 16
Front suspension: Independent, type McPherson with coil Spring and anti-roll bar
Rear suspension: Independent multi-link Spring suspension with stabilizer
